Aashish Karna Work Experience Details
  • Enflux Engineering Ltd.
    Mechanical Engineer In Training
    Enflux Engineering Ltd. Apr 2022 - Present
    Perform a Level 1 and Level 2 Fitness-For-Service Assessment on penstocks to analyze the general condition and stresses and to determine the minimum required thickness, maximum allowable working pressure and remaining life of the P4 steel penstock.Create a transient model based on the existing turbine information and penstock alignment to validate the existing transient information.Perform a transient analysis using Bentley Hammer to analyze and validate the pressure surge in the existing penstocks and the water level variation in the existing surge tower.Develop a replacement option for the penstock by running transient simulations on different alignments involving the merger of two smaller penstocks into a single, larger penstock. Develop a design for the new surge tower and conduct a sensitivity analysis based on the surge tower and orifice diameter parameters and the head losses across the orifice.Conduct transient analysis on several operating scenarios and determine the governing cases.
  • Bba Consultants
    Mechanical Engineer In Training
    Bba Consultants Oct 2020 - Feb 2022
    - Perform Level 1 and Level 2 Fitness-For-Service Assessments on penstocks to analyze the condition and to determine the minimum required thickness, maximum allowable working pressure and remaining life of steel penstocks and surge towers.- Perform transient analysis using Bentley Hammer to analyze the pressure surge in the penstock and the water level variation in the differential surge tower during a load rejection.- Perform simulations to study the effect of the head loss coefficient of the orifices in a differential surge tower.- Perform simulations to test the effect of different gate closing times to compare surge pressures and turbine overspeed for various scenarios.- Conduct load rejection tests on site to validate the transient model against load rejection data.- Validate the surge tower head loss coefficient for the orifices on the differential surge tower based on the transient data from load rejection testing.- Develop repair/replacement recommendations for penstocks and surge towers.- Prepare progress reports and detailed inspection reports- Prepare 3D models and conduct simulations in ANSYS to analyze the stress, strain and deflection of penstocks.- Design repair and replacement options for penstock refurbishment projects following ASCE and ASME standards.- Conduct simulations on new designs for validation.- Design a modular diesel powerplant to replace existing diesel generators at 3 separate locations in Yukon.- Prepare general arrangement drawings and detailed design of the powerplant.- Prepare P&IDs for the fuel system, energy recovery and heating systems, and closed loop cooling systems for the units- Develop a Design Basis Report for all mechanical systems.- Perform a Root Cause Analysis for the deformation seen in the penstocks.- Prepare a report with the findings and recommendations to restore the penstocks.- Prepare repair drawings and memorandums to support repairs on site.
